inculpate

/ˈɪnkʌlpeɪt/
verb
  1. To accuse or blame someone; to show that someone is guilty of a crime or wrongdoing.
    • The witness's testimony did not inculpate anyone directly.
    • The new evidence seemed to inculpate the suspect further.
    • He refused to inculpate his friends during the interrogation.
